Nestled in the guts of Palermo, the Museo Nacional de Arte Decorativo is often a treasure trove for art lovers and layout aficionados alike. Housed within the amazing Errazuriz Palace, an exquisite example of French neoclassical architecture crafted amongst 1911 and 1916, this museum offers visitors a glimpse into Argentina's aristocratic previous.
